Uses of Interface
org.hibernate.sql.results.graph.DomainResultAssembler
Packages that use DomainResultAssembler
Package
Description
Defines the runtime mapping metamodel, which describes the mapping
of the application's domain model parts (entities, attributes) to
relational database objects (tables, columns).
Defines domain result graphs.
-
Uses of DomainResultAssembler in org.hibernate.metamodel.mapping
Method parameters in org.hibernate.metamodel.mapping with type arguments of type DomainResultAssemblerModifier and TypeMethodDescriptiondefault Object[]
EntityMappingType.extractConcreteTypeStateValues
(Map<AttributeMapping, DomainResultAssembler> assemblerMapping, RowProcessingState rowProcessingState) Deprecated, for removal: This API element is subject to removal in a future version. -
Uses of DomainResultAssembler in org.hibernate.metamodel.mapping.internal
Methods in org.hibernate.metamodel.mapping.internal that return DomainResultAssemblerModifier and TypeMethodDescriptionCompoundNaturalIdMapping.DomainResultImpl.createResultAssembler
(InitializerParent<?> parent, AssemblerCreationState creationState) ToOneAttributeMapping.NullDomainResult.createResultAssembler
(InitializerParent parent, AssemblerCreationState creationState) -
Uses of DomainResultAssembler in org.hibernate.query.sqm.sql.internal
Methods in org.hibernate.query.sqm.sql.internal that return DomainResultAssemblerModifier and TypeMethodDescriptionSqmMapEntryResult.createResultAssembler
(InitializerParent<?> parent, AssemblerCreationState creationState) -
Uses of DomainResultAssembler in org.hibernate.sql.results.graph
Classes in org.hibernate.sql.results.graph that implement DomainResultAssemblerModifier and TypeClassDescriptionclass
class
Methods in org.hibernate.sql.results.graph that return DomainResultAssemblerModifier and TypeMethodDescriptionFetch.createAssembler
(InitializerParent<?> parent, AssemblerCreationState creationState) Create the assembler for this fetchDomainResult.createResultAssembler
(InitializerParent<?> parent, AssemblerCreationState creationState) Create an assembler (and any initializers) for this result. -
Uses of DomainResultAssembler in org.hibernate.sql.results.graph.basic
Classes in org.hibernate.sql.results.graph.basic that implement DomainResultAssemblerModifier and TypeClassDescriptionclass
class
ABasicResultAssembler
which does type coercion to handle cases where the expression type and the expected resultJavaType
are different (e.g.Methods in org.hibernate.sql.results.graph.basic that return DomainResultAssemblerModifier and TypeMethodDescriptionBasicFetch.createAssembler
(InitializerParent<?> parent, AssemblerCreationState creationState) BasicFetch.createResultAssembler
(InitializerParent<?> parent, AssemblerCreationState creationState) BasicResult.createResultAssembler
(InitializerParent<?> parent, AssemblerCreationState creationState) BasicResult.getAssembler()
For testing purposes only -
Uses of DomainResultAssembler in org.hibernate.sql.results.graph.collection.internal
Classes in org.hibernate.sql.results.graph.collection.internal that implement DomainResultAssemblerFields in org.hibernate.sql.results.graph.collection.internal declared as DomainResultAssemblerModifier and TypeFieldDescriptionprotected final @Nullable DomainResultAssembler<?>
AbstractCollectionInitializer.collectionKeyResultAssembler
refers to the collection's container value - which collection-key?protected final @Nullable DomainResultAssembler<?>
AbstractImmediateCollectionInitializer.collectionValueKeyResultAssembler
refers to the rows entry in the collection.Methods in org.hibernate.sql.results.graph.collection.internal that return DomainResultAssemblerModifier and TypeMethodDescriptionCollectionFetch.createAssembler
(InitializerParent<?> parent, AssemblerCreationState creationState) DelayedCollectionFetch.createAssembler
(InitializerParent<?> parent, AssemblerCreationState creationState) CollectionDomainResult.createResultAssembler
(InitializerParent parent, AssemblerCreationState creationState) abstract DomainResultAssembler<?>
AbstractImmediateCollectionInitializer.getElementAssembler()
ArrayInitializer.getElementAssembler()
BagInitializer.getElementAssembler()
ListInitializer.getElementAssembler()
MapInitializer.getElementAssembler()
SetInitializer.getElementAssembler()
abstract @Nullable DomainResultAssembler<?>
AbstractImmediateCollectionInitializer.getIndexAssembler()
ArrayInitializer.getIndexAssembler()
BagInitializer.getIndexAssembler()
ListInitializer.getIndexAssembler()
MapInitializer.getIndexAssembler()
SetInitializer.getIndexAssembler()
-
Uses of DomainResultAssembler in org.hibernate.sql.results.graph.embeddable.internal
Classes in org.hibernate.sql.results.graph.embeddable.internal that implement DomainResultAssemblerFields in org.hibernate.sql.results.graph.embeddable.internal declared as DomainResultAssemblerModifier and TypeFieldDescriptionprotected final DomainResultAssembler<?>[][]
EmbeddableInitializerImpl.assemblers
Methods in org.hibernate.sql.results.graph.embeddable.internal that return DomainResultAssemblerModifier and TypeMethodDescriptionAggregateEmbeddableFetchImpl.createAssembler
(InitializerParent<?> parent, AssemblerCreationState creationState) EmbeddableFetchImpl.createAssembler
(InitializerParent<?> parent, AssemblerCreationState creationState) AggregateEmbeddableResultImpl.createResultAssembler
(InitializerParent<?> parent, AssemblerCreationState creationState) EmbeddableExpressionResultImpl.createResultAssembler
(InitializerParent<?> parent, AssemblerCreationState creationState) EmbeddableForeignKeyResultImpl.createResultAssembler
(InitializerParent<?> parent, AssemblerCreationState creationState) EmbeddableResultImpl.createResultAssembler
(InitializerParent<?> parent, AssemblerCreationState creationState) -
Uses of DomainResultAssembler in org.hibernate.sql.results.graph.entity.internal
Classes in org.hibernate.sql.results.graph.entity.internal that implement DomainResultAssemblerFields in org.hibernate.sql.results.graph.entity.internal declared as DomainResultAssemblerModifier and TypeFieldDescriptionprotected final DomainResultAssembler<?>
EntitySelectFetchInitializer.keyAssembler
Methods in org.hibernate.sql.results.graph.entity.internal that return DomainResultAssemblerModifier and TypeMethodDescriptionAbstractNonJoinedEntityFetch.createAssembler
(InitializerParent<?> parent, AssemblerCreationState creationState) DiscriminatedEntityFetch.createAssembler
(InitializerParent<?> parent, AssemblerCreationState creationState) EntityFetchJoinedImpl.createAssembler
(InitializerParent<?> parent, AssemblerCreationState creationState) DiscriminatedEntityResult.createResultAssembler
(InitializerParent<?> parent, AssemblerCreationState creationState) EntityResultImpl.createResultAssembler
(InitializerParent parent, AssemblerCreationState creationState) protected @Nullable DomainResultAssembler<?>[][]
EntityInitializerImpl.getAssemblers()
protected DomainResultAssembler<?>
EntityDelayedFetchInitializer.getIdentifierAssembler()
protected DomainResultAssembler<?>
EntityInitializerImpl.getIdentifierAssembler()
@Nullable DomainResultAssembler<?>
EntityInitializerImpl.getKeyAssembler()
EntitySelectFetchInitializer.getKeyAssembler()
protected @Nullable DomainResultAssembler<Object>
EntityInitializerImpl.getRowIdAssembler()
protected @Nullable DomainResultAssembler<?>
EntityInitializerImpl.getVersionAssembler()
-
Uses of DomainResultAssembler in org.hibernate.sql.results.graph.instantiation.internal
Classes in org.hibernate.sql.results.graph.instantiation.internal that implement DomainResultAssemblerModifier and TypeClassDescriptionclass
Specialized QueryResultAssembler for use as a "reader" for dynamic- instantiation arguments.class
class
class
A QueryResultAssembler implementation representing handling for dynamic- instantiations targeting a List (per-"row"), E.g.`select new list( pers.name, pers.dateOfBirth ) ...`class
A QueryResultAssembler implementation representing handling for dynamic- instantiations targeting a Map, e.g.`select new map( pers.name, pers.dateOfBirth ) ...`Methods in org.hibernate.sql.results.graph.instantiation.internal that return DomainResultAssemblerModifier and TypeMethodDescriptionDynamicInstantiationResultImpl.createResultAssembler
(InitializerParent<?> parent, AssemblerCreationState creationState) BeanInjection.getValueAssembler()
Constructors in org.hibernate.sql.results.graph.instantiation.internal with parameters of type DomainResultAssemblerModifierConstructorDescriptionArgumentReader
(DomainResultAssembler<A> delegateAssembler, String alias) BeanInjection
(org.hibernate.sql.results.graph.instantiation.internal.BeanInjector beanInjector, DomainResultAssembler valueAssembler) -
Uses of DomainResultAssembler in org.hibernate.sql.results.graph.tuple
Classes in org.hibernate.sql.results.graph.tuple that implement DomainResultAssemblerMethods in org.hibernate.sql.results.graph.tuple that return DomainResultAssemblerModifier and TypeMethodDescriptionTupleResult.createResultAssembler
(InitializerParent<?> parent, AssemblerCreationState creationState) TupleResult.getAssembler()
For testing purposes only -
Uses of DomainResultAssembler in org.hibernate.sql.results.internal
Classes in org.hibernate.sql.results.internal that implement DomainResultAssemblerConstructors in org.hibernate.sql.results.internal with parameters of type DomainResultAssemblerModifierConstructorDescriptionStandardRowReader
(DomainResultAssembler<?>[] resultAssemblers, Initializer<?>[] resultInitializers, Initializer<?>[] initializers, Initializer<?>[] sortedForResolveInitializers, boolean hasCollectionInitializers, RowTransformer<T> rowTransformer, Class<T> domainResultJavaType) -
Uses of DomainResultAssembler in org.hibernate.sql.results.internal.domain
Methods in org.hibernate.sql.results.internal.domain that return DomainResultAssemblerModifier and TypeMethodDescriptionCircularBiDirectionalFetchImpl.createAssembler
(InitializerParent<?> parent, AssemblerCreationState creationState) CircularFetchImpl.createAssembler
(InitializerParent<?> parent, AssemblerCreationState creationState) -
Uses of DomainResultAssembler in org.hibernate.sql.results.jdbc.internal
Methods in org.hibernate.sql.results.jdbc.internal that return DomainResultAssemblerConstructors in org.hibernate.sql.results.jdbc.internal with parameters of type DomainResultAssemblerModifierConstructorDescriptionJdbcValuesMappingResolutionImpl
(DomainResultAssembler<?>[] domainResultAssemblers, boolean hasCollectionInitializers, InitializersList initializersList) -
Uses of DomainResultAssembler in org.hibernate.sql.results.jdbc.spi
Methods in org.hibernate.sql.results.jdbc.spi that return DomainResultAssembler